The new HP Slate 7 Android tablet today is hitting store shelves. It is a nice device with low-end specs but with an appropriate low-end price tag.It comes with a 7-inch 1024×600 display and runs on a dual-core ARM Cortex A9 chip clocked at 1.6GHz. Inside there’s 1GB of RAM, 8GB of internal storage, and a 3,500mAh battery.

According to latest news, the 7-inch budget-friendly tablet will start shipping in “1 to 2 weeks” in the UK.The Slate 7 will cost £129 (VAT included) in the Kingdom, which is roughly $195.HP’s tab packs a slower, dual-core 1.6 GHz CPU under the hood, a smaller battery and sports a lower-res, 1,024 x 600 7-inch display. It also comes with Beats Audio sound enhancement, microSD support and dual cameras.

Amazon Germany, a traditionally quick retailer to put device listings up, has added the webOS 2.2 QWERTY slider to its online catalog at a price of €449 ($640).
HP Pre 3 is a 3.6-inch smartphone with a WVGA (800 x 480) resolution, a 1.4GHz Qualcomm MSM8x55 processor, 512MB of RAM, and a pair of cameras, the rear of which can record 720p video and 5 megapixel stills.

AT&T has released the webOS powered HP Veer 4G smartphone.
The handset arrives sporting features to include a 2.6 inch (320 x 400)
touchscreen display, 800MHz Qualcomm processor, slide-out QWERTY
keyboard, GPS, HSPA+,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 2.1 + EDR, 8GB internal storage, a
5 megapixel camera, 910 mAh battery and is available for
$99.99 with contract.
